当钱包会‘自证清白’:透视TPWallet的开源与安全全景

想象你的钱包会窃窃私语:每次签名都是对信任的一次判决。

关于tpwallet是否开源,最权威的检索路径是官方GitHub、官网公告与社区声明。截止最近公开资料,未见到tpwallet主干代码被全面开源,但其部分SDK或集成工具可能在公共仓库出现;因此判断应以官方发布为准(参考:各项目GitHub策略与开源许可文档)。

便捷支付网关:tpwallet作为支付入口,应支持交易构建、元交易(meta-transactions)、气费抽象(如ERC-4337)、以及第三方relayer。流程通常为:商户发起订单 → 支付网关组装交易(含支付授权与费付策略)→ 用户在tpwallet侧确认并签名(EIP-712文本化签名可提升可读性)→ relayer或节点广播并返回收据。此链路关键点是用户体验与防重放、链上/链下一致性。

账户监控:高质量钱包集成实时监控与告警。实现方式包括基于RPC订阅、区块链索引器(如The Graph)及Lightweight webhook。监控指标覆盖:异常转出、合约批准量(ERC-20 approve)、链上授权变化。企业级方案常用SIEM接入与NIST/OWASP安全基线(参考NIST SP 800系列、OWASP ASVS)。

数字货币应用:tpwallet若开放生态,可承载DeFi入口、NFT管理、跨链桥接与质押功能。合约层面需实现可组合接口(ERC-20/721/1155)与安全的资产交互编排,配合前端签名策略实现最小权限授权。

高安全性钱包与区块链安全:核心在密钥管理(BIP-39/44、硬件安全模块、TEE/SE或MPC阈值签名如GG18)、审计与漏洞管理。合约应通过静态分析、形式化验证与第三方审计(CertiK、Trail of Bits等)并部署赏金计划。多重签名、时锁、白名单与冷热分离是常见防线。

技术解读与合约技术要点:推荐采用EIP-712提升签名语义、EIP-1271支持合约签名验证、并审慎使用代理模式(透明代理/可升级代理)以平衡可升级性与安全性。合约设计应遵循最小权限原则、避免重入、处理整数溢出并实现事件完整日志。

详细流程分析(精简步骤):1) 用户/商户发起支付请求;2) 网关预校验并生成需签名的有结构数据;3) tpwallet弹窗提示并通过安全模块签名;4) 签名随交易经relayer或节点广播;5) 链上确认后索引器更新并触发监控告警/回调;6) 审计与异常回滚路径。

结语:判定tpwallet是否开源必须以官方仓库与许可为准;无论开源与否,构建便捷支付网关与高安全性钱包离不开标准化签名、严密的密钥管理、审计与实时监控。建议在生产环境上线前,查阅官方代码仓库与独立安全审计报告(参考OpenZeppelin、CertiK、NIST文档)。

请选择或投票:

1) 我希望tpwallet全面开源并接受社区审计。

2) 我更在意tpwallet的企业级安全与闭源审计保证。

3) 我关心便捷支付网关的用户体验超过完全开源。

4) 我想了解tpwallet的具体SDK与GitHub地址(请提供)。

作者:周辰发布时间:2025-08-19 09:52:39

评论

相关阅读
<style dropzone="dflid"></style><acronym dir="jhsr6"></acronym><font draggable="2uwca"></font><ins dropzone="io44m"></ins><kbd date-time="w3ddq"></kbd><tt dir="uzg_4"></tt>